Yes, Boston College MBA programs offer a variety of experiential learning opportunities that allow students to gain real-world experience and apply their knowledge in practical settings. Here are some of the experiential learning opportunities available:
Program | Description |
---|---|
Field Projects | Students have the opportunity to work on consulting projects with real companies, providing valuable insights and recommendations. |
Global Immersions | Students can participate in international trips to gain a global perspective on business practices and challenges. |
Internships | Students can secure internships with top companies to gain hands-on experience and build their professional network. |
Case Competitions | Students can participate in case competitions to solve real business problems and present their solutions to industry experts. |
These experiential learning opportunities not only enhance students' academic experience but also prepare them for success in their future careers. Boston College MBA programs are committed to providing a well-rounded education that combines theoretical knowledge with practical skills.
